Hailey Van Lith‘s illustrious career ended in the Elite Eight.
The point guard scored 17 points, but it was not enough as No. 2 seed TCU was knocked out of the women’s NCAA Tournament by No. 1 Texas 58-47 on Monday at the Legacy Arena at the BJCC in Birmingham, Alabama.
REQUIRED READING: TCU star Hailey Van Lith confirmed an unusual fact about herself
Van Lith was the Big 12 Player of the Year, Big 12 Newcomer of the Year, First-team All-Big 12 and Big 12 tournament Most Outstanding Player this season. She, however, struggled against the Longhorns, finishing 3 of 15 shots from the field and turning the ball over seven times. The finalist for Naismith and an All-American after transferring in from LSU, she finished with eight rebounds.
The point guard reached the Elite Eight all five years of her collegiate career with Louisville, LSU and TCU. Here’s how Van Lith performed in her final collegiate game:

TCU vs Texas: Hailey Van Lith points today
- Points: 17 (final)
- Rebounds: 8
- Assists: 2
- Steals: 1
- FG percentage: 3-of-15
- 3-point percentage: 1-for-3
- FT percentage: 10-of-11
Hailey Van Lith stats 2024-25
Here’s a look at Van Lith’s stats during the 2024-25 season, entering play on Monday.
- Points per game: 17.9
- Rebounds per game: 4.5
- Assists per game: 5.5
- Steals per game: 1.2
- FG percentage: 46%
- 3-point percentage: 33.9%
- FT percentage: 82.1%
